File as soon as possible after discovery to preserve evidence.
Initial review commonly takes 2–8 weeks, depending on workload.
Recipients often have 30 days to respond to a complaint.
If unresolved, allow 30–90 days before escalating to court or regulator.
Statute of limitations varies by claim—verify with counsel.
Begin with full names, vehicle identifiers, and legal status of each party to avoid ambiguity and ensure proper service and jurisdictional clarity.
Present events in order with dates, mileage, repair attempts, and outcomes to build a coherent factual narrative for reviewers or adjudicators.
Attach invoices, warranty copies, inspection reports, photos, and prior communications to substantiate the claim and reduce follow-up inquiries.
Cite the statutory or contractual provision relied on, such as warranty terms, the Song-Beverly Consumer Warranty Act, or specific contract clauses when applicable.
Specify repair, replacement, refund, diminution in value, or other relief with dollar amounts or objective terms when appropriate.
Conclude with dated signature(s) and contact details to authenticate the filing and enable follow-up communications.
